Macron: Hezbollah represents a part of the Lebanese people
French President Emmanuel Macron said on Tuesday that he does not know newly designated Prime Minister Mostapha Adib, voicing hopes that he “has the required efficiency.”
Macron’s comments were made during his tour at the damaged sites in Beirut port whereby he noted that he suggested “a follow-up mechanism for the next few months.”
“We will not release the funds of Cedar Conference as long as reforms are not implemented,” he stressed.
He also stressed importance of the swift formation of a new Cabinet, the implementation of reforms in the electricity sector, fighting corruption, among others.
On another note, Macron said that the current Parliament was elected by the Lebanese people, adding that the people must produce a new political reality during the next parliamentary elections.
“Hezbollah is a party that represents a part of the Lebanese people and has been elected, there is a partnership today between this party and several other parties, and if we do not want Lebanon to slide into a model in which terrorism dominates at the expense of other matters, then Hezbollah and other parties must be made aware about their responsibilities,” he added.
Macron concluded by saying that the "truth of the numbers" in the Lebanese banking system needed to be known, calling for an audit.
